State Unprepared For Severity Of "Nilam": YSRCP
“The Government should openly admit its failure in anticipating the intensity of the natural calamity..."
Hyderabad | 6th November 2012
The YSR Congress party on Tuesday came down heavily on the state government for its total failure in anticipating the intensity of the Nilam cyclone and the resultant floods in the state.
Addressing media persons here, party MLA G Srikanth Reddy demanded that the government make immediate arrangements for payment of financial relief to the victims who suffered property and crop losses due to the heavy floods. He said that there were neither medical camps nor drinking water supplies in the flood-hit areas. Heavy property and crop losses occurred in Krishna, Guntur, Prakasham and Godavari districts because of the government’s negligence, and the victims should be compensated immediately.
Taking objection to Minister Raghuvera Reddy’s announcement that there was no danger from Nilam, Srikanth Reddy sought an explanation from the Minister on what basis he made the statement. “The Government should openly admit its failure in anticipating the intensity of the natural calamity, and take steps for immediate relief to the farmers and others who lost their crops and property,” he demanded.
It is good that the government has announced ex-gratia for the families of those who lost their lives in the floods, but an immediate announcement of relief for others is also important, he said.
Srinkanth Reddy objected to the statements of some ministers that central teams would visit to assess the flood damage. “What is the use of such teams? The government has not yet paid the input subsidy promised to farmers during the Jal cyclone in the past,” he remarked.
Criticising TDP President N Chandrababu Naidu, the YSRCP leader said that Naidu was desperate for power and his visits to the flood hit areas seemed to be aimed at votes. During his nine-year rule, Naidu never thought of irrigation, drainage system and loan or interest waiver but now he is making all sorts of promises to the people. “He kept quiet when Karnataka built projects during his rule and because of that we are experiencing the floods now,” he said, adding that people won’t believe his promises going by his past record.
